The Anatomy of BC.Game’s Bonus Landscape

Before we can analyze claiming habits, it’s essential to understand the buffet of bonuses BC.Game typically offers. Unlike traditional fiat casinos, crypto platforms often have a more dynamic and sometimes more complex bonus structure.

Welcome Bonuses and First Deposit Incentives

These are, by far, the most common entry points for new players. BC.Game, like many others, offers multi-tiered welcome packages, often matching initial deposits across several transactions. The claiming frequency here is usually high, driven by the initial excitement and the desire to maximize starting capital. Analysts should consider the “stickiness” of these bonuses – do players who claim the first tier also claim subsequent tiers, or does interest wane? This can indicate the perceived value of the later stages of the welcome package.

Reload Bonuses and Daily/Weekly Promotions

Beyond the initial welcome, BC.Game keeps players engaged with a steady stream of reload bonuses, often tied to specific days or events. These might include deposit matches, free spins on popular slots, or even cashback offers. The claiming frequency here offers a real-time pulse on player activity. A dip in claiming these regular bonuses could signal player fatigue, a less appealing offer, or increased competition from other platforms. Conversely, consistently high claim rates suggest a well-tuned promotional calendar that resonates with the player base.

Task-Based and Loyalty Program Bonuses

BC.Game also incorporates gamified elements, offering bonuses for completing specific tasks (e.g., reaching a certain wagering volume, trying new games) or through its VIP/loyalty program. These bonuses are often more targeted and require active participation beyond just making a deposit. The claiming frequency here is a strong indicator of player engagement with the platform’s ecosystem and their perceived value of the loyalty rewards. Low claim rates might suggest the tasks are too difficult, the rewards aren’t enticing enough, or the loyalty program itself isn’t well understood.

Shitcodes and Other Unique Crypto-Specific Promotions

A unique aspect of crypto casinos like BC.Game is the prevalence of “shitcodes” – essentially bonus codes often distributed through social media, forums, or community channels. These are often time-sensitive and create a sense of urgency. Analyzing the claim rate of these unique, often spontaneous, promotions can reveal the strength of a platform’s community engagement and the effectiveness of its social media marketing. High claim rates here suggest a highly active and attentive player base.

Factors Influencing Bonus Claiming Frequency

Several variables play a significant role in how often players at BC.Game, or any online casino, decide to claim a bonus.

Wagering Requirements and Terms & Conditions

This is arguably the most critical factor. Bonuses with excessively high wagering requirements, short expiry periods, or restrictive game contributions will naturally see lower claim rates. Players are savvy; they understand that a “free” bonus isn’t truly free if the hoops to jump through are too numerous or too high. Analysts should correlate claim rates with the transparency and fairness of bonus terms.

Perceived Value of the Bonus

Is the bonus genuinely attractive? A small bonus with reasonable terms might be claimed more often than a large bonus with prohibitive conditions. The type of bonus also matters: some players prefer free spins, others prefer deposit matches, and high rollers might be more interested in cashback. BC.Game’s ability to segment its audience and offer tailored bonuses will directly impact claim rates.

Player Segmentation and Behavioural Patterns

Different player segments will have different bonus claiming habits. New players are often eager to claim welcome bonuses. High rollers might be less interested in small free spin offers but highly value VIP perks and high-percentage reload bonuses. Casual players might only claim bonuses when they are about to make a deposit anyway. Understanding these segments is key to predicting and influencing claim rates.

Communication and Visibility of Offers

If players aren’t aware of a bonus, they can’t claim it. The effectiveness of BC.Game’s in-platform notifications, email marketing, and social media presence directly impacts bonus visibility and, consequently, claim rates. Is the bonus information clear, concise, and easy to find?

Overall Player Experience and Trust

Ultimately, if players trust the platform and enjoy their overall experience, they are more likely to engage with its promotions. A platform with a reputation for fair play, excellent customer service, and a wide selection of games will naturally foster higher bonus claim rates because players feel confident investing their time and money.
